WebbOff-screen dialogue is when a character is speaking and isn’t seen when a character is in the area but not visible. How to write off-screen dialogue in a Script? You write off-screen dialogue by writing the abbreviation “(O.S.)” after the character’s name in a …
Webb22 jan. 2024 · Off-Screen (O.S.) differs from Voice Over in that the character is present , just not seen. O.S. means off screen, in the sense of the character being nearby -- in the same room or area -- but not in camera range at the moment. Or in the next room, and within voice range. Whereas V.O. means Voice Over. As in voice over narration, or ... when we hear a Voice Over a radio (or TV, walky-talky, etc.). Jeff Newman stewart rpm surfboardWebb5 aug. 2024 · OFF SCREEN (O.S.) When a character is speaking and is heard by other characters, but can't be seen by the audience or other characters. Just write (O.S.) next … stewart royal tartan scarfWebb5 aug. 2024 · There are two hard and fast rules for capitalization in screenplay format. Always capitalize a character's name the first time they appear in the action/description, and always capitalize screenplay transitions.
